Directions

  1. Combine orange juice (or liquor) and raisins in a small bowl and let stand overnight (or--if you are like me and want to make them right now--cover and microwave for 1 minute, cool covered).
  2. Beat butter and sugar in a large bowl until fluffy.
  3. Beat in egg and orange peel.
  4. Combine flour and baking soda in another large bowl and stir into butter mixture.
  5. Add raisins, any soaking liquid, and oats and mix well.
  6. Drop dough by rounded teaspoonfuls onto greased baking sheets, spacing 2 inches apart and flattening slightly.
  7. Bake at 350°F 10 to 12 minutes.
  8. Transfer to racks and cool completely.
  9. Microwave chocolate and oil 3 to 4 minutes on low power in a small deep bowl, stirring once.
  10. Let stand 2 minutes, stir until smooth.
  11. Dip one-third of cookie in chocolate and set on waxed paper.
  12. Chill until chocolate is firm.
  13. STRIP VERSION:
  14. Divide dough into 4 equal portions.
  15. Place 2 portions, at least 6 inches apart, on baking sheet.
  16. Pat each portion into a 12-inch-long log with well-floured hands (dough will be sticky) and flatten each log to 1 1/2 inches wide.
  17. Bake until golden brown, 12 to 14 minutes.
  18. Cool on baking sheets 2 minutes.
  19. Cut logs diagonally into 1-inch-wide strips.
  20. Follow directions for dipping cookies.
